## Runbook: Brightkit versioning

Quick refresher for support folks: the Brightkit component library follows strict semver, but apps at Lanternworks pin to minor versions, so a patch bump can land without a ticket. If a customer reports a UI glitch, first check which Brightkit version their tenant resolved at build time. Mismatches between tenants usually mean a stale pin. The resolver picks versions based on these configuration values:

settings of kagup-tagug:
ULAIX_HOST=ulaix.zemvarsys.internal
ULAIX_PORT=8000

Capacity note: Fernwick's shared component library, Lattice UI, now publishes pinned versions per consumer tier. Each minor release fans out builds to roughly forty downstream services, so the registry and build farm must absorb the spike within the hour. Budget for three concurrent minor releases plus one emergency patch per week. Storage grows ~2 GB per release train; prune anything past the retention window. Do not change fan-out limits without a capacity review. Current provisioning constants are as follows.

tuning table, kajog-kawef:
PRIORITIES = {
    "kelox": 870,
    "kasix": 89,
    "eliax": 988,
}

**Ticket #4182 — Bulk edit silently drops checkbox selections**

Hey plugin folks — if you hook into the Quillbase admin table, heads up. Repro: select 30+ rows, apply a bulk status change, scroll during the request. Rows below the fold revert to unselected and get skipped. No error shown. Workaround: paginate to 25 rows max. To test against our staging bulk-edit endpoint, authenticate using the bearer token below.

portal login ticket: eyJhbGciOiJIUzI1NiIsInR5cCI6IkpXVCJ9.eyJzdWIiOiIMjvRAf3PEFIn0.nuv9gjixLtnr